In-Depth Exploration of Male Hormone Blood Testing Procedures

A male patient undergoing a blood test for testosterone, LH, and FSH, with hormone level charts.

A male hormone blood test serves as a crucial diagnostic tool that assesses the levels of various hormones present in a man's bloodstream, with a significant focus on testosterone. This vital hormone is essential for regulating numerous physiological functions, including libido, energy levels, emotional balance, and the maintenance of muscle mass. When hormonal imbalances occur, they can lead to various health issues, underscoring the importance for men to understand their hormonal health status. The test evaluates not only testosterone but also other essential hormones like luteinising hormone (LH) and follicle-stimulating hormone (FSH), offering a holistic perspective on male reproductive health and overall endocrine function.

Gaining insights from these comprehensive tests is vital for diagnosing conditions such as hypogonadism, erectile dysfunction, and infertility. Furthermore, fluctuations in hormone levels can significantly affect emotional and mental health, emphasising the importance of this test in the context of comprehensive health management for men. By understanding their hormone levels, individuals can take proactive measures toward enhancing their well-being.

Comprehending the Male Hormone Blood Test Procedure

A healthcare professional drawing blood from a male patient's arm in a clinic, using a needle and tourniquet.

The process of undergoing a male hormone blood test is typically straightforward, primarily involving a simple blood draw. This procedure usually takes place at a local clinic or laboratory, with results commonly available within a few days, making it an accessible option for many men.

During the test, a healthcare professional will clean the area of the arm designated for the blood draw, apply a tourniquet to engorge the veins, and insert a needle to collect the blood sample. After the draw, patients may experience minor discomfort or bruising, but these effects are generally short-lived. Familiarising oneself with the testing procedure and potential outcomes can alleviate anxiety, helping individuals prepare for their healthcare journey effectively.

Effectively Interpreting Your Male Hormone Blood Test Results

Understanding Your Hormone Levels and Their Health Implications

Interpreting the results of a male hormone blood test is essential for understanding one’s health status. Test results typically display levels of various hormones alongside reference ranges, indicating whether the levels fall within normal, low, or high brackets. For example, testosterone levels are generally considered normal if they range between 300 and 1,000 ng/dL.

If hormone levels deviate from these reference ranges, it may signal potential health concerns that warrant further investigation. For instance, low testosterone levels can suggest hypogonadism, while elevated levels may be associated with other health issues, such as adrenal gland disorders. Understanding these results is vital for initiating appropriate discussions with healthcare providers.
